进入项目,我们可以在package Manager当中查看Shader Graph插件是否已经正常安装 之后 我们在资源管理面板当中选择符合自己项目渲染管线的shader Graph 双击之后,unity就会打开这个shader graph 之后你可以调整fragment片元着色器输出的颜色 获取挂载了这个shadergraph的材质 在shadergraph里面创建属性 调整颜色之后赋
参考链接:https://discussions.unity.com/t/shader-graph-custom-function-... 我找到了一种在 CustomNode 中使用 SubGraph 的方法: 首先,需要找到子图函数的名称 您需要创建一个单独的子图节点,右键单击它并选择“显示生成的代码”。在这段代码中,你需要找到名为SG_[name of SubGraph][a lot of random symbols...
【小猫unity教程】2D 简单闪电特效 shader graph 、sub graph 入门级讲解, 视频播放量 4979、弹幕量 22、点赞数 144、投硬币枚数 81、收藏人数 240、转发人数 5, 视频作者 小猫学游戏, 作者简介 独立游戏小学生,相关视频:【小猫Unity教程】5分钟制作 动态水波纹效果
子图(subgraph) subgraph可以保存通用的蓝图,并可以在其他的shaderGraph调用。 选中需要保存的蓝图,右击鼠标选择Convert To→Sub-gragh,弹出文件保存栏,命名保存。 使用的时候,在新的ShaderGraph直接拖入subgraph桥接就可以使用。单独点开subgraph也可以打开面板。 注释 框选注释(GroupSelection) 选中需要注释的蓝图,右击选择...
Sub Graph 子图,用于创建一些可复用的节点Unlit Graph 不受光照的图 ShaderGraph窗口 我们先创建一个PBRGraph来看一看。双击graph文件即可打开ShaderGraph窗口。 ShaderGraph的图是以节点和连线组成的,默认创建出来会有一个Master Node(主节点)。你可以通过把其他节点连接到Master Node来创造你想要的效果。 编辑节点的...
在Unity 中制作基于文件的自定义节点 (Custom Node) 与子图 (Sub Graph)。 同时如果你能够有下面这些能力,能获得更通顺的阅读体验(当然没有也行): 下载了 Unity 2021.2 版本 简单接触过 Unity 的 URP Shader 代码编写,并且使用过 Shader Graph。 懂得访问不存在的网站,或者能够登录 Github。
Shader Graph是Unity强大的可视化着色器编辑工具,下面我将详细介绍如何使用它实现溶解效果及其他复杂材质交互。 一、溶解效果基础实现 1. 创建基础溶解Shader 新建Shader Graph: 右键Project窗口 → Create → Shader Graph → URP/Lit Graph 命名为"DissolveEffect" ...
了解详情 2021.2 版本中 Shader Graph 中令人兴奋的新功能将帮助您解锁大大改进的艺术家工作流程和着色器性能。 了解详情 发现更多艺术家工具 利用Unity 强大且艺术家友好的解决方案释放您的想象力。利用专门设计的工具获得更大的灵活性,帮助您实时、更快地工作。
Unity 2018 推出 Shader Graph,可视化工具简化着色器制作。兼容 URP 和 HDRP,无需代码,拖拽节点创建效果。含 Blackboard、Graph Inspector 等模块,支持自定义节点。适用于游戏开发,提升画面质量,缩短周期,未来将更普及优化。
PBR Graph:(physically based rendering)用于制作基于物理的Shader,可以用于金属或镜面效果等。 **Unlit Graph:**用于制作无光照效果的Shader **Sub Graph:**子模块,类似于我们代码中的函数,会有一个Output(也就是return)来输出值。我们可以通过设置自定义输出的类型以及个数等。